In this article, unless the context otherwise requires:
1. "Associate director" means the associate director of the division.
2. "Division" means the animal services division of the Arizona department of agriculture.
3. "Label" means any display of written, printed or graphic matter on the immediate container of any real or trade product, or any such matter affixed to any such product or affixed to or appearing upon a package or wrapping containing any such product. For purposes of this paragraph, "container" shall include the lid, cap, top or any other removable or separable part, as well as the container itself.
4. "Real product" or "real milk product" means a dairy product which contains milk solids-not-fat and which may contain milk fat, but in no event contains:
(a) Any other oils or fats.
(b) Any replacement or substitute for any part of the whole milk. A nutritious, wholesome and healthful additive may be contained in such a product, provided such additive is not a replacement or substitute for any part of the whole milk.
5. "Trade product" means a product which has the appearance, taste, smell, texture or color of, but is not, a real product; which, taken as a whole, bears resemblance to or is in imitation of a real product, or could be mistaken for a real product.
